United Therapeutics UTHR 359.58 (-0.16%)
US91307C1027•
Biotechnology•
Biotechnology
United Therapeutics (UTHR) Stories
Here is a selected set of our story library related to United Therapeutics (UTHR).
Here is a selected set of our story library related to United Therapeutics (UTHR).